Why Do Candles Help with Anxiety and Stress?
There's a reason why candles have been used for centuries in various cultures for relaxation and healing. The simple act of lighting a candle and focusing on its flame helps to ground us in the present moment, which is essential when we’re feeling anxious or stressed. When you light a candle, it creates a soft, gentle glow that can help soothe the mind and shift the focus away from overwhelming thoughts. But it's not just the visual element that provides relief; it's also the fragrance. Certain scents have been scientifically shown to have calming effects on the nervous system. For instance, lavender is known for its ability to promote calmness, while eucalyptus can help clear the mind. These scents help stimulate the olfactory system, sending signals to the brain that promote relaxation. Lighting a candle with the right fragrance can, therefore, become a key part of managing anxiety and stress in a natural, holistic way.
1. Lavender Candles: The Ultimate Calming Fragrance
If there’s one scent that’s universally associated with relaxation, it’s lavender. I’ve always turned to lavender-scented candles when I’m feeling anxious, and it’s no surprise that it’s often referred to as nature’s calming remedy. Studies have shown that the scent of lavender can reduce heart rate and lower blood pressure, both of which are often elevated when we're stressed or anxious. The soothing floral aroma of lavender helps signal the brain to relax, making it easier to breathe deeply and let go of tension. I have a lavender candle in my bedroom, and I light it before bed to signal to my body that it's time to unwind. The calming effects of lavender are so potent that it’s a common ingredient in many sleep aids and relaxation products. For those looking for immediate anxiety relief, I recommend trying a lavender candle before your meditation or evening routine for maximum effect.
2. Chamomile Candles: A Gentle Soother
Chamomile is another gentle scent that’s often used to ease anxiety. Known for its calming properties, chamomile has been used for centuries in teas and essential oils to promote relaxation. When I light a chamomile-scented candle, it creates an atmosphere that feels cozy and peaceful, which is perfect for unwinding after a busy day. Chamomile can help with anxiety relief by calming the nervous system and promoting a sense of safety and comfort. What I love about chamomile candles is that they aren’t overpowering in scent. The fragrance is soft and subtle, making it a great choice if you prefer a more delicate aroma in your space. If you're someone who finds it difficult to unwind before bed, a chamomile candle could be the perfect addition to your nighttime ritual. Its soothing nature pairs wonderfully with calming tea or a warm bath for an even more relaxing experience.

5. Sandalwood Candles: Grounding and Soothing
For those who prefer deeper, woodsy fragrances, sandalwood is a fantastic option. Sandalwood has been revered for centuries for its grounding properties. The rich, earthy scent has a calming effect that helps reduce feelings of anxiety by creating a sense of stability and security. Personally, I love burning a sandalwood candle during my meditation practice. It helps me stay grounded and present in the moment. Sandalwood is also an excellent choice if you want a fragrance that is warm and comforting but not too overpowering. The earthy undertones of sandalwood make it a great option for creating a calming atmosphere in living rooms or offices, particularly if you prefer a scent that feels more natural and soothing. It’s perfect for relieving anxiety and adding a touch of tranquility to your environment.
6. Bergamot Candles: A Boost for the Mind
If you're looking for something that not only calms but also boosts your mood, bergamot candles are an excellent choice. Bergamot is a citrus fruit known for its uplifting and energizing properties. Its refreshing, citrusy aroma is known to reduce stress and anxiety while improving overall mood and mental clarity. When I need to clear my head and feel more focused, I reach for a bergamot-scented candle. It has a subtle, slightly floral scent with a citrus twist that refreshes the senses. Studies have shown that bergamot oil can significantly reduce symptoms of anxiety and depression, making bergamot candles a great option for those dealing with emotional stress. Lighting a bergamot candle in the morning or during the workday can help set a positive tone and help you stay mentally clear, calm, and collected throughout the day.
Tips for Using Candles for Anxiety Relief
Using candles to alleviate anxiety is not only about the scent but also about creating a calming environment. Here are a few tips I’ve found helpful when using candles to promote relaxation:
1. Set the Scene
To get the most out of your candle, create a peaceful environment. Dim the lights, play soft music, and take a few moments to breathe deeply. I like to set aside time to sit and focus on the candle flame, which helps center my thoughts and calm my mind.
2. Combine with Other Relaxation Techniques
While candles can certainly promote relaxation, combining them with other calming techniques such as yoga, meditation, or a warm bath can enhance the experience. This multi-sensory approach helps amplify the relaxing effects of the candle and brings you deeper into a state of calm.
3. Use Candles Regularly
The more consistently you use calming candles, the more they’ll become associated with relaxation in your mind. I recommend making candle lighting part of your daily or nightly routine to help train your brain to associate the scent with a peaceful state of mind.
